Russian fighter Alexander Kuznetsov returned to life 52 minutes after cardiac arrest due to timely measures taken by doctors. Andrey Kondrakhin, a general practitioner and Candidate of Medical Sciences, told about this on Friday, September 19.
"This is very rare, which indicates that the body has a good opportunity to adapt to such an unpleasant situation, plus its young age, and taking certain actions before the hospitalization stage played a role," he said in an interview with aif.ru .
He added that the professional actions of the doctors allowed him to survive.
Earlier that day, military doctor Alexander Babiev said that a seriously wounded soldier of a special military operation (SVO), whose heart stopped, revived after 52 minutes on the operating table, IA Regnum reports.
According to the medic, the fighter was admitted to the hospital in serious condition, his left leg was crushed, and there was also a huge loss of blood. His heart stopped seven minutes before he was admitted to the operating room. Doctors tried to resuscitate Kuznetsov even after the hope of salvation was almost completely reduced to zero.
52 minutes later, the fighter's heart started beating again, according to the website. kp.ru . Babiev called the incident a miracle.
According to the specialist, the incident is called Lazarus syndrome.
